Rumour Control: AMD Radeon RX 5300 XT spotted

A new graphics card from team red may have been broken cover out in the wild, with the AMD Radeon RX 5300 XT making a suprirse appearance in a prebuilt PC.

The upcoming AMD Radeon RX 5300 XT has appeared. A report from German website Computerbase.de shows that the graphics cards have appeared on the specifications for HP desktop PCs offered for pre-order at the retailer alternate.de.

The exact specification of the RX 5300 XTs are not given, only that they are listed as having 4GB of GDDR5 memory. Between this slice of the specification and the implication in the name, (400 arbitrary units one way or the other in the context of the names of graphics cards of the same generation are not to be sniffed at) this should place the RX 5300 XT somewhere around the entry level for AMD graphics cards.

The PCs listed with the RX 5300 XTs in the specification had been slated for pre-order and due to arrive on October 8th. This suggests that the next wave of AMD graphics cards is extremely close.
